Visa & Travel Requirements
U.S. citizens do not need a visa for short tourist visits to Sweden. Here’s what you should know before your trip:
- Americans can visit Sweden and other Schengen Area countries for up to 90 days within any 180-day period without a visa.
- You must have a valid U.S. passport. It’s recommended that your passport is valid for at least three months beyond your planned departure from the Schengen Area.
- Border officials may ask for proof of onward travel or a return ticket, confirmation of accommodation, and evidence of sufficient funds for your stay.
- Sweden is part of the Schengen Area, allowing seamless travel between member countries during your visit.
- Starting in 2026, Americans will need ETIAS approval to enter Sweden and other Schengen countries. Be sure to apply online before your trip once ETIAS is in effect.
RV Parking in Stockholm
Public transportation is great in Stockholm, so the easiest way to park and explore the city is to find a train station near your campground with a parking area, and then take the train into the city. You can also park in the Aimo Park at Stockholm University and walk to the Universitetet train station.

Water Tank Info
When you rent a camper van in Stockholm, you’ll need to fill it up with fresh water at the beginning of your trip and empty the grey water at the end.
It’s possible to fill up fresh water at gas stations with self-wash points in Sweden. However, we advise that you use a spare water bottle to collect the fresh water due to possible contamination from the hose.
Unlike other European countries, there are fewer roadside points with facilities to empty black water, so it may be best to drain your wastewater at your campground at the end of your adventure.
Best Time to Visit Stockholm
If you want to know the best time to rent a camper van in Stockholm, then you’ll have to decide what you want from your trip. Are you looking for a winter wonderland or do you want to experience midsummer revelry? Springtime has the least rain and beautiful blossoms in the city’s parks, while in the fall, the foliage turns yellow and red, mirroring many of the city’s buildings. As with many destinations, spring is probably the best time of year to visit Stockholm, when the winter chill dissipates, but before the crowds of summer arrive. However, many visitors say that June and August are the months when the city feels most alive, although it should be noted that many locals leave for their summer cottages for most of July.
